Cloud Testing
Developers should learn cloud testing to efficiently test applications in scalable, real-world scenarios, especially for cloud-native, microservices, or globally distributed systems where traditional testing falls short

Simulator Testing
Developers should use simulator testing when they need to test applications in environments that are difficult, expensive, or risky to replicate physically, such as testing on multiple mobile devices, simulating rare network issues, or validating embedded software without hardware access
Pros
- +It is particularly valuable in agile development cycles for early bug detection, reducing costs associated with physical devices, and ensuring cross-platform compatibility, making it essential for mobile, automotive, and IoT projects
